## Onboarding: Quillspool Service

Quillspool is Harrowfield's printer-spooler microservice. It handles queue management, driver negotiation, and render jobs for all office sites. Audit logs ship to the central sink hourly; access is role-gated through our internal IdP.

For your review environment, the sealed config bundle must be unlocked with the recovery passphrase provided below.

unlock words, yawig-kagef: gordor-holvan-ulaael-pramir-ulaiel-tamdor

**Ticket: Deep links bouncing to the store page on staging**

Hey — Fernwick deep-link routing on staging keeps kicking users to the app store instead of the target screen. Turns out the staging env file is missing the router credential entirely, so the resolver falls back to default behavior. Easy fix for the next release cut: add this line to staging's `.env`.

env line for fafof-fahag: LEDGER_TOKEN5=f8790

Step 6: Apply the drift-compensation patch to the Verdanthaus greenhouse controller. The humidity sensors in Bay C drift roughly 2% per week, so the patch recalibrates against the reference probe every six hours and logs deltas to the Mosskeep service. Reviewers should confirm the calibration window is configurable and that the fallback uses the last known-good offset rather than raw readings. After approval, package the firmware and sign it before flashing; the controller bootloader verifies signatures. The signing key is below.

signing key of hahag-tahag = bky4_v18e